From mboxrd@z Thu Jan 1 00:00:00 1970 From: Joseph Myers To: gcc-gnats@gcc.gnu.org Cc: jsm28@cam.ac.uk Subject: other/3386: Undocumented target macros in 3.0 Date: Fri, 22 Jun 2001 17:46:00 -0000 Message-id: X-SW-Source: 2001-06/msg01005.html List-Id: >Number: 3386 >Category: other >Synopsis: Undocumented target macros in 3.0 >Confidential: no >Severity: serious >Priority: medium >Responsible: unassigned >State: open >Class: doc-bug >Submitter-Id: net >Arrival-Date: Fri Jun 22 17:46:01 PDT 2001 >Closed-Date: >Last-Modified: >Originator: Joseph S. Myers >Release: 3.0 >Organization: none >Environment: System: Linux digraph 2.4.5 #1 Sat May 26 09:50:17 UTC 2001 i686 unknown Architecture: i686 host: i686-pc-linux-gnu build: i686-pc-linux-gnu target: i686-pc-linux-gnu configured with: ../gcc-3.0/configure --prefix=/usr --with-slibdir=/lib --enable-shared --enable-threads=posix --with-system-zlib >Description: The following target macros are present in 3.0 but not in 2.95.3, and are undocumented, which is a regression. ASM_OUTPUT_DWARF_PCREL ASM_SIMPLIFY_DWARF_ADDR BUILD_VA_LIST_TYPE CONST_SECTION_ASM_OP CONVERT_HARD_REGISTER_TO_SSA_P CRT_END_INIT_DUMMY CRT_GET_RFIB_DATA DWARF_FRAME_REGISTERS EXPAND_BUILTIN_VA_ARG EXPAND_BUILTIN_VA_START HARD_REGNO_RENAME_OK IA64_UNWIND_EMIT IA64_UNWIND_INFO IDENT_ASM_OP INTEL_EXTENDED_IEEE_FORMAT MAX_LONG_DOUBLE_TYPE_SIZE MD_FALLBACK_FRAME_STATE_FOR STABS_GCC_MARKER TARGET_EBCDIC TARGET_ESC TDESC_SECTION_ASM_OP >How-To-Repeat: >Fix: Document these macros. >Release-Note: >Audit-Trail: >Unformatted: